When something is turned upside down, it can also be described as being bottom-side up. However, there are a few alternative synonyms that can be used to convey the same meaning. One similar phrase is "inverted," which specifically references the act of flipping something over so that what was once at the top is now at the bottom. Another possible synonym is "upended," which suggests that something has been turned over completely or forcefully. Additional options include "reversed," which can indicate a deliberate or unintentional backwards position, or "topsy-turvy," a whimsical phrase that brings to mind a playful, chaotic state of affairs.
